This recipe was extracted from High-class cookery recipes (1897) by Edith Nicolls Clarke, page 13.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.

Lobster Souffle. Ingredients. Two Whitings. One Hen Lobster. One gin of Cream. Two ounces of Butter. Two ounces of Flour. One gill of Fish Stock made from bones of the Whitings. Four Eggs
